Assigning Network 2 Timeslots to Network 1 Interface Timeslots

If you are using a 9261 Dual T1 NAM, you can assign Network 2 interface
timeslots to Network 1 interface timeslots.

"

Procedure

1. Follow this menu selection sequence:

Configuration Edit/Display

Cross Connect

Network to Network

Assignments

2. The Network to Network Assignments screen appears. This screen contains

a matrix of the current cross-connect status of all time slots on the Network 1
interface.

3. Move the cursor to the next editable timeslot (underlined). Use the spacebar

or type in the desired timeslot to display the desired timeslot assignment.

4. Repeat Step 3 until all desired timeslots are assigned. Select Save to save

the assignments, or press ESC to save and return to the Cross Connect
menu.

Network to Network Signaling Assignments and Trunk Conditioning

The second page of the Network to Network Assignments screen enables you to
define the signaling assignments and trunk conditioning for each timeslot on the
Network 1 interface.

Only those Network-to-Network assignments from page 1 are displayed on this
page, from left to right and top to bottom in ascending order, by network timeslot.

See

DSX-1 Signaling Assignments and Trunk Conditioning

on page 5-40 for more

information.

Enter one of the values shown in Table 5-8 in each of the fields on both the
Network 1 side and the Network 2 side. Although you can choose any value for
the Network 2 side (except None), the default value displayed is based on a
typical setting that would be used with the corresponding Network 1 side value.
Typical pairs of values are shown in Table 5-8, with the Network 1 side on the left
side of the table and the Network 2 side on the right side of the table. If you
change the setting of None to anything else, the Network 2 side value is changed
to the corresponding default value.
